Honda has launched its new electric scooter named U-GO. It is designed for urban riding as the scooter is light-weight . Honda U-GO has been launched in two versions i.e., the scooter has two different speeds and power.

The first model is the standard model which comes with a top speed of 53 kmph, it comes with a 1.2 kW and a motor that can create a peak output of 1.8 kW. 

The second model comes with the lower speed model that's 43 kmph ,it sports an 800 W continuous hub motor with a peak power of 1.2 kW. 

Moreover both the models offer a 48V and 30Ah removable lithium-ion battery . The capacity of the battery is 1.44 kWh. The powertrain offers a range of 65 km, which can be increased by 130 km by the addition of a second battery.

Honda U GO Price in India

The price of the all new Honda U-GO varies depending on its model. The price of the first model (high speed) is CNY 7,999, which is around Rs 91,860 in Indian currency and the second model (low speed)is 7,499 RMB ($1,150) which is ₹85,000 in Indian currency.

Honda U GO Design

The scooter has a clean and minimalist yet sporty design which will appeal to younger buyers,It has LED headlight with triple beams on the front apron and an LED DRL strip encircling the main cluster.The indicators of the scooter are neatly integrated on the sides of the handlebar. The blacked-out panels on the handlebar, floorboard, underbelly, tail section, rear suspension and rear mudguard add a sporty contrast to the scooter.

At the back it reflects the light of the LED tail and the single-lane rail that covers the body. It has a long floorboard 350mm in diameter. The black panels on the handlebar, floorboard, underbelly, tail section, rear suspension and rear mudguard add hints of sport diversity. A single flat seat promises easy ergonomics for riding

Honda U GO Features

The features of the U-Go e-scooter is quite interesting as it gets a fairly spacious boot with an under-seat storage capacity of 26 litres. It too has LED illumination, a utility glove box, an anti-theft alarm and a USB charging port. One of the most important features is that it gets an LCD instrument console which provides information like speed, range, battery status and riding mode. The scooter runs on 12-inch front and 10-inch rear alloy wheels.

Honda U GO Specifications

The most important specification of U-Go is that it is powered with a 48V 30Ah Lithium-ion battery The battery is a removable battery pack which is coupled with a 1.2kW hub motor on the regular model. The second variant that is the low-speed variant gets a less powerful 800W motor. The powertrain returns a maximum range of 65km which can be doubled to 130km by the addition of a second battery. The addition of the second battery comes at the cost of reduced under-seat storage.The regular variant, which is a high speed variant, offers a top speed of 53 kmph. The weight of the scooter is just 83kg kerb.

The Suspension duties of the U-Go are handled by telescopic forks at front and dual shock absorbers at rear with preload adjustability. The braking system consists of a disc brake at front and a drum brake at rear. It has a very accessible seat height of 740mm.
